There are many systems which can work just fine in an eventually-consistent manner. A database of people (customers, users, etc) is a classic example of such a thing. In general I think consistency is over valued. There are plenty of cases where it is important. Lots of people are brainwashed in college to think that all data must be consistent all the time, and that's just not necessary. |
